Just came home and noticed our electric meter box outside the house was open, and there was a black box in it...a quick google makes me think it is the sender unit for an E-on energy monitor. We have no idea where it's come from or anything...we are not with eon, never have been. We've not ordered an energy monitor. It's a detached bungalow so no chance of confusing our box with the neighbours...any idea's where it's come from or why anyone would fit one to our meter box?
